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 41,119 with 26,325 female students and 14,794 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, University of North Georgia has the most enrolled students of 18,029, while South Georgia State College has the least number of students of 1,793 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 35,984 with 22,380 female students and 13,604 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, University of North Georgia has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 17,240, while South Georgia State College has the least number of undergraduate students of 1,793.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 5,135 with 3,945 female students and 1,190 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, University of West Georgia has the most enrolled graduate students of 3,227, while Albany State University has the least number of graduate students of 522.

Distance Learning (Online Class) Enrollment

The following table compares 2022-2023 distance learning enrollment for both undergraduate and graduate programs between selected colleges. In undergraduate programs, out of total 35,984 students, 7,790 students (21.65%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 14,746 students (40.98%) have learned from at least one online course. For graduate schools, out of total 5,135 students, 3,932 students (76.57%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 731 students (14.24%) have learned from at least one online course.
